Listening to Multi-Track Sound
Try Now
Select Audio Options > Multi-Track Sound. Configure the audio for the current broadcast. Multi-
Track Sound can be set to mono or stereo, depending on the broadcast signal or program.
However, this option is automatically set to mono if the broadcast signal or program does not
support stereo.
"
Press the INFO button to view the current broadcast's audio signal information.
"
For the LED 7100 series, press the KEYPAD button, select TOOLS on the On-Screen Remote, and then
select INFO to view the current broadcast's audio signal information.
"
While watching TV, press the KEYPAD button on the Samsung Smart Control, select TOOLS on the On-
Screen Remote, and then select Multi-Track Sound. On the standard remote, press the TOOLS button,
and then select Multi-Track Sound.
Fine-Tuning the Screen
MENU > Broadcasting > Channel Settings > Fine Tune
Try Now
"
Available for analog broadcasts only.
Analog pictures can become shaky and full of noise. If this happens, you can fine-tune the signal
and/or reduce noise to clear up the picture.
1.
Select Broadcasting > Channel Settings > Fine Tune. An adjustment bar appears on the screen.
2.
Press the
¡
or
£
button to make adjustments. Select Save or Close to apply the new setting.
Select Reset to reset the Fine-Tune operation.
